## Service Accounts — StormFan Alert Fan-Out

The fan-out worker authenticates to the internal dispatch tier using the svc-stormfan account. Rotate quarterly; scopes are limited to publish-only on alert topics. If deliveries stall during your shift, verify the worker is using the current credential, reproduced below for reference.

API key for kaweg-hahif: kto4_rAjZ

Step 4: Deploy the Ledgerlight audit-log viewer to the staging ring. Confirm the retention policy file is mounted read-only and that the viewer can page through at least 10,000 entries without timeout. Do not proceed until the checksum of the bundle matches the release notes. Before promoting, verify the artifact against the deploy key shown below.

release key, fahaf-bajof: bky3_Xam

**Action item #7 — waveform preview timeouts (owner: whoever picks this up, probably you)**

Welcome aboard! Context: during the Sablewood incident, the audio waveform preview in Chorusline kept timing out on long podcast uploads, which backed up the render queue and cascaded into the upload UI. Root cause was a too-aggressive render timeout plus an undersized worker pool. We've agreed on new values, but they need to be wired into the preview service config and verified on staging. The agreed constants are:

tuning table, yajog-yahof:
BUDGETS = {
    "lamvan": 303,
    "wenox": 460,
    "fenvan": 525,
}